IN NO EVENT SHALL THE COPYRIGHT OWNER OR CONTRIBUTORS BE// L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, SPECIAL, EXEMPLARY, OR// CONSEQUENTIAL DAMAGES (INCLUDING, BUT NOT LIMITED TO, PROCUREMENT OF// SUBSTITUTE GOODS OR SERVICES; LOSS OF USE, DATA, OR PROFITS; OR BUSINESS// INTERRUPTION) HOWEVER C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N// CONTRACT, STRICT LIABILITY, O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E)// ARISING IN ANY WAY OUT OF THE USE OF THIS SOFTWARE, EVEN IF ADVISED OF THE// POSSIBILITY OF SUCH DAMAGE.//// Author: darius.rueckert@fau.de (Darius Rueckert)//#include "ceres/internal/array_selector.h"#include "gtest/gtest.h"namespace ceres {namespace internal {// This test only checks, if the correct array implementations are selected. The// test for FixedArray is in fixed_array_test.cc. Tests for std::array and// std::vector are not included in ceres.TEST(ArraySelector, FixedArray) {  ArraySelector<int, DYNAMIC, 20> array1(10);  static_assert(      std::is_base_of<internal::FixedArray<int, 20>, decltype(array1)>::value,      "");  EXPECT_EQ(array1.size(), 10);  ArraySelector<int, DYNAMIC, 10> array2(20);  static_assert(      std::is_base_of<internal::FixedArray<int, 10>, decltype(array2)>::value,      "");  EXPECT_EQ(array2.size(), 20);}TEST(ArraySelector, Array) {  ArraySelector<int, 10, 20> array1(10);  static_assert(std::is_base_of<std::array<int, 10>, decltype(array1)>::value,                "");  EXPECT_EQ(array1.size(), 10);  ArraySelector<int, 20, 20> array2(20);  static_assert(std::is_base_of<std::array<int, 20>, decltype(array2)>::value,                "");  EXPECT_EQ(array2.size(), 20);}TEST(ArraySelector, Vector) {  ArraySelector<int, 20, 10> array1(20);  static_assert(std::is_base_of<std::vector<int>, decltype(array1)>::value, "");  EXPECT_EQ(array1.size(), 20);  ArraySelector<int, 1, 0> array2(1);  static_assert(std::is_base_of<std::vector<int>, decltype(array2)>::value, "");  EXPECT_EQ(array2.size(), 1);}}  // namespace internal}  // namespace ceres
